Rotor Shaft

ROTOR SHAFT. The rotor shaft forms the heart of the electric motor. High demands are placed on rotor shafts, among other things in terms of transmittable torque, run-out and technical cleanliness. EN8 Steel | BS970 080M40

EN8 carbon steel is a British grade as per BS 970 standard.It has medium carbon content with 0.36-0.44% which gives it medium tensile strength.EN8 steel is generally supplied in untreated condition or normalized condition.For further process,it can be flame or induction hardened to produce a good surface hardness(50-55HRC) and …

Modular Rotor Shafts in Electrified Trucks | ATZheavy duty

The rotor shaft, as a central component of the electric motor, must be able to withstand high rotational speed, have low imbalance and demonstrate high strength due to the loads that occur during operation. ...
